Gladys’ texts are not ‘seriously corrupt’

The point at which the disclosure of a romantic relationship is necessary must now be clarified to avoid deterring women from contributing to politics while searching for love.

The National Anti-Corruption Commission (NACC) started on July 1, and after just one day it had before it 49 referrals for investigation. It remains to be seen whether those referrals come from concerned citizens reporting genuine suspicions of corruption, or from political apparatchiks keen to immediately weaponise it as a tool for the takedown of enemies.

By its very design, there is substantial risk that it will be used for the latter purpose.
